WHAT IS BAPTISM?

Baptism is an outward expression of an inward reality. It symbolizes your inner cleansing from sin, your new birth in Christ Jesus, and it's a mark of Christian discipleship that has been practiced by the Church from its very beginning.

ARE YOU READY TO BE BAPTIZED?

If you understand and agree with these three questions, you're likely ready to be baptized:

  1. Do you acknowledge and profess the Christian faith as taught in the Holy Scriptures?

  2. Do you repent from sin and do you acknowledge Jesus Christ as your Savior and Lord?

  3. Are you determined by the grace of God to live the Christian life?
